TV Size Calculator Viewing Distance Formula and Mathematical Explanation
The math behind TV Size Calculator Viewing Distance involves two primary factors: field of view (FOV) and angular resolution. The Society of Motion Picture and Television Engineers (SMPTE) and THX have established standards for the most immersive viewing angles.
The basic formulas used are:
- THX Standard (40° Angle): Viewing Distance (inches) = Screen Diagonal / 0.84
- SMPTE Standard (30° Angle): Viewing Distance (inches) = Screen Diagonal / 0.625
- Visual Acuity: Distance = (Screen Height) / (tan(1/60 degrees)). This calculates the point where the human eye can no longer see individual pixels.
| Variable | Meaning | Unit | Typical Range |
|---|---|---|---|
| Screen Size | Diagonal length of the panel | Inches | 32 – 100 |
| FOV | Field of View Angle | Degrees | 20° – 40° |
| PPI | Pixels Per Inch | Density | Varies by size |
Practical Examples (Real-World Use Cases)
Example 1: The Modern Living Room
If you purchase a 65-inch 4K TV, our TV Size Calculator Viewing Distance suggests an optimal "cinema" distance of approximately 6.5 feet (THX standard). If your couch is currently 9 feet away, you might actually benefit from an even larger screen, like a 75-inch or 85-inch model, to fully appreciate the 4K resolution.
Example 2: Small Apartment Setup
For a bedroom with a 43-inch 1080p TV, the TV Size Calculator Viewing Distance indicates that you should sit about 5.5 to 6 feet away. If you sit closer than 4.5 feet, you will begin to notice pixelation, making the 1080p image look "soft" or blurry compared to 4K.

Key Factors That Affect TV Size Calculator Viewing Distance Results
1. Native Resolution: High-resolution screens (4K and 8K) allow for much closer TV Size Calculator Viewing Distance because the pixels are smaller and more densely packed.
2. Visual Acuity (Eyesight): A person with 20/20 vision will notice pixels sooner than someone with 20/40 vision. Our TV Size Calculator Viewing Distance assumes standard 20/20 vision.
3. Content Quality: If you are watching low-resolution cable TV on a large 4K set, you should sit further back than the TV Size Calculator Viewing Distance suggests to mask compression artifacts.
4. Room Lighting: Bright rooms may require a closer position to maintain perceived contrast, while dark home theaters allow for the immersive wide FOV suggested by THX.
5. Personal Comfort: Some users find a 40-degree field of view overwhelming, causing "eye travel" where you have to move your eyes to see different parts of the screen. In this case, use the SMPTE 30-degree TV Size Calculator Viewing Distance.
6. Screen Height: It is generally recommended that your eyes are level with the center of the screen. If the TV is mounted high (like over a fireplace), the effective TV Size Calculator Viewing Distance changes due to the viewing angle.
Frequently Asked Questions (FAQ)
1. Is a 65-inch TV too big for a 10-foot distance?
According to the TV Size Calculator Viewing Distance, 10 feet is actually at the far end for a 65-inch 4K TV. You would likely find an 75-inch or even 85-inch screen more immersive at that distance.
2. Does 8K really require sitting closer?
Yes, to see the benefits of 8K, the TV Size Calculator Viewing Distance must be very short—often half the distance of 4K—otherwise, your eye cannot distinguish the extra detail.
3. What is the THX viewing distance standard?
THX recommends a 40-degree field of view for a cinematic experience, which our TV Size Calculator Viewing Distance calculates as Screen Size divided by 0.84.
4. Can sitting too close damage my eyes?
While it won't cause permanent damage, sitting closer than the TV Size Calculator Viewing Distance suggests can lead to digital eye strain and fatigue.
5. What if I have a curved TV?
The TV Size Calculator Viewing Distance remains largely the same, but the "sweet spot" for curved screens is more restrictive, usually requiring you to sit exactly centered.
6. How does resolution affect the formula?
Resolution defines the "Visual Acuity" limit. Higher resolution lowers the minimum TV Size Calculator Viewing Distance before the picture looks pixelated.
7. Should I follow the SMPTE or THX recommendation?
THX is for "cinema-like" immersion. SMPTE is for general viewing. Use our TV Size Calculator Viewing Distance to find a middle ground between the two.
8. Does screen technology (OLED vs LED) matter?
While technology affects color and contrast, it doesn't change the geometric TV Size Calculator Viewing Distance based on size and resolution.
